aboutsummaryrefslogtreecommitdiff
path: root/src/main/java
diff options
context:
space:
mode:
authorBedrock-Armor <146508555+Bedrock-Armor@users.noreply.github.com>2025-06-10 21:44:50 -0600
committerGitHub <noreply@github.com>2025-06-10 23:44:50 -0400
commit66fb7bed8c1a66cfa0396f688ed1a41b31296773 (patch)
tree72d70a405958cfd7f36ee180f712cb061c843ce7 /src/main/java
parentc6d6f09f1f072070956ad00f1c828fe8e2450199 (diff)
downloadSkyblocker-66fb7bed8c1a66cfa0396f688ed1a41b31296773.tar.gz
Skyblocker-66fb7bed8c1a66cfa0396f688ed1a41b31296773.tar.bz2
Skyblocker-66fb7bed8c1a66cfa0396f688ed1a41b31296773.zip
Update EnchantmentLevelAdder.java (#1338)
* Update EnchantmentLevelAdder.java Adds the new enchants found on Alpha, and changes a couple pre-existing abbreviations to make the new ones fit better; also accounts for Alpha renaming the Syphon enchant to Drain * Update EnchantmentLevelAdder.java * Update EnchantmentLevelAdder.java
Diffstat (limited to 'src/main/java')
-rw-r--r--src/main/java/de/hysky/skyblocker/skyblock/item/slottext/adders/EnchantmentLevelAdder.java17
1 files changed, 12 insertions, 5 deletions
diff --git a/src/main/java/de/hysky/skyblocker/skyblock/item/slottext/adders/EnchantmentLevelAdder.java b/src/main/java/de/hysky/skyblocker/skyblock/item/slottext/adders/EnchantmentLevelAdder.java
index 872a7bd6..e7d52a77 100644
--- a/src/main/java/de/hysky/skyblocker/skyblock/item/slottext/adders/EnchantmentLevelAdder.java
+++ b/src/main/java/de/hysky/skyblocker/skyblock/item/slottext/adders/EnchantmentLevelAdder.java
@@ -32,8 +32,10 @@ public class EnchantmentLevelAdder extends SimpleSlotTextAdder {
static {
// Normal enchants (A - Z)
+ ENCHANTMENT_ABBREVIATIONS.put("absorb", "AB");
ENCHANTMENT_ABBREVIATIONS.put("angler", "AN");
ENCHANTMENT_ABBREVIATIONS.put("aqua_affinity", "AA");
+ ENCHANTMENT_ABBREVIATIONS.put("arcane", "AR");
ENCHANTMENT_ABBREVIATIONS.put("aiming", "DT"); // Dragon tracer
ENCHANTMENT_ABBREVIATIONS.put("bane_of_arthropods", "BA");
@@ -70,9 +72,10 @@ public class EnchantmentLevelAdder extends SimpleSlotTextAdder {
ENCHANTMENT_ABBREVIATIONS.put("feather_falling", "FF");
ENCHANTMENT_ABBREVIATIONS.put("ferocious_mana", "FM");
ENCHANTMENT_ABBREVIATIONS.put("fire_aspect", "FA");
- ENCHANTMENT_ABBREVIATIONS.put("fire_protection", "FP");
+ ENCHANTMENT_ABBREVIATIONS.put("fire_protection", "FI");
ENCHANTMENT_ABBREVIATIONS.put("first_strike", "FS");
ENCHANTMENT_ABBREVIATIONS.put("flame", "FL");
+ ENCHANTMENT_ABBREVIATIONS.put("forest_pledge", "FP");
ENCHANTMENT_ABBREVIATIONS.put("fortune", "FO");
ENCHANTMENT_ABBREVIATIONS.put("frail", "FR");
ENCHANTMENT_ABBREVIATIONS.put("frost_walker", "FW");
@@ -119,6 +122,7 @@ public class EnchantmentLevelAdder extends SimpleSlotTextAdder {
ENCHANTMENT_ABBREVIATIONS.put("punch", "PU");
ENCHANTMENT_ABBREVIATIONS.put("quantum", "QU");
+ ENCHANTMENT_ABBREVIATIONS.put("quick_bite", "QB");
ENCHANTMENT_ABBREVIATIONS.put("rainbow", "RA");
ENCHANTMENT_ABBREVIATIONS.put("reflection", "RF");
@@ -127,25 +131,28 @@ public class EnchantmentLevelAdder extends SimpleSlotTextAdder {
ENCHANTMENT_ABBREVIATIONS.put("respiration", "RE");
ENCHANTMENT_ABBREVIATIONS.put("respite", "RS");
- ENCHANTMENT_ABBREVIATIONS.put("scavenger", "SC");
+ ENCHANTMENT_ABBREVIATIONS.put("scavenger", "SV");
+ ENCHANTMENT_ABBREVIATIONS.put("scuba", "SC");
ENCHANTMENT_ABBREVIATIONS.put("sharpness", "SH");
ENCHANTMENT_ABBREVIATIONS.put("silk_touch", "ST");
ENCHANTMENT_ABBREVIATIONS.put("small_brain", "SB");
ENCHANTMENT_ABBREVIATIONS.put("smarty_pants", "SP");
ENCHANTMENT_ABBREVIATIONS.put("smelting_touch", "SE");
ENCHANTMENT_ABBREVIATIONS.put("smite", "SI");
- ENCHANTMENT_ABBREVIATIONS.put("smoldering", "SL");
+ ENCHANTMENT_ABBREVIATIONS.put("smoldering", "SD");
ENCHANTMENT_ABBREVIATIONS.put("snipe", "SN");
ENCHANTMENT_ABBREVIATIONS.put("spiked_hook", "SK");
+ ENCHANTMENT_ABBREVIATIONS.put("stealth", "SL");
ENCHANTMENT_ABBREVIATIONS.put("strong_mana", "SM");
ENCHANTMENT_ABBREVIATIONS.put("sugar_rush", "SR");
ENCHANTMENT_ABBREVIATIONS.put("sunder", "SU");
- ENCHANTMENT_ABBREVIATIONS.put("syphon", "SY");
+ ENCHANTMENT_ABBREVIATIONS.put("syphon", "DR"); // Drain
ENCHANTMENT_ABBREVIATIONS.put("tabasco", "TA");
ENCHANTMENT_ABBREVIATIONS.put("thorns", "TN");
ENCHANTMENT_ABBREVIATIONS.put("thunderbolt", "TB");
ENCHANTMENT_ABBREVIATIONS.put("thunderlord", "TL");
+ ENCHANTMENT_ABBREVIATIONS.put("tidal", "TD");
ENCHANTMENT_ABBREVIATIONS.put("titan_killer", "TK");
ENCHANTMENT_ABBREVIATIONS.put("toxophilite", "TX");
ENCHANTMENT_ABBREVIATIONS.put("transylvanian", "TY");
@@ -231,4 +238,4 @@ public class EnchantmentLevelAdder extends SimpleSlotTextAdder {
private static int getEnchantLevelFromString(String str) {
return RomanNumerals.romanToDecimal(str.substring(str.lastIndexOf(' ') + 1)); //+1 because we don't need the space itself
}
-} \ No newline at end of file
+}